O Se-hoon Rides Saebyeokdonghaeng Autonomous Bus: "Cutting-Edge Technology Prioritized for the Vulnerable"

Accompanying Early Morning Commuters on the 28th, Hearing Their Hardships
Departing Up to 30 Minutes Earlier Than the First City Bus
Official Operation of 'Dobongsan Station~Yeongdeungpo Station' Begins in October
Mayor Oh: "Will Thoroughly Prepare After Pilot Operation"

On the early morning of the 28th, Seoul Mayor Oh Se-hoon boarded the 'Sae-byeok Donghaeng Autonomous Bus' and promised to accompany the socially vulnerable through advanced transportation innovation, stating, "Advanced technology should be used first and foremost for the socially disadvantaged." The 'Sae-byeok Donghaeng Autonomous Bus' is scheduled to officially operate from October on the Dobongsan Station to Yeongdeungpo Station route (25.7km). It departs around 3:30 AM, up to 30 minutes earlier than the first city bus.

On the day, ahead of the 2nd anniversary of the 8th term of the elected government on the 1st, Mayor Oh boarded the autonomous bus from Jongno 4-ga Gwangjang Market central stop to Chungjeongno Station. Traveling with four early morning workers including sanitation workers and security guards, Mayor Oh listened to their hardships and opinions, saying, "Going forward, we will continue to accompany citizens who open Seoul’s early mornings through advanced transportation innovation, alleviating difficulties of early morning and late-night commutes even a little, and resolving blind spots in public transportation."


Earlier, in May at the Abu Dhabi Annual Investment Meeting, Mayor Oh personally announced the 'People-first Advanced Transportation Innovation Strategy,' stating that the direction for the second half of the administration would focus on new industry growth and advanced transportation innovation that socially vulnerable and marginalized groups can feel in their daily lives. In line with this, Seoul City decided to deploy the first 'Sae-byeok Donghaeng Autonomous Bus' route covering the northeast to southwest areas, selecting the Dobongsan Station to Yeongdeungpo Station section for official operation starting in October. There are also plans to continuously deploy the buses on routes with heavy congestion on the first early morning buses, such as from Sanggye to Gangnam.


Additionally, as part of the 'Oh Se-hoon-style People-centered Advanced Transportation Innovation,' Seoul plans to expand 'region-customized autonomous buses' to transportation-disadvantaged areas far from subway stations and metropolitan areas where commuting to and from Seoul is inconvenient, thereby resolving blind spots in public transportation. Mayor Oh said, "While accumulating data through the autonomous bus pilot operation, I heard from workers who have to commute in the early morning hours that even bus drivers hesitate to work at that time, and these workers have no choice but to take taxis to get to work due to lack of buses." He added, "After the pilot operation, we will thoroughly prepare and promote this bus so that those who truly need it can use it at the times they need."
